Description
OpenStack Octavia through 18.0.0 mishandles quality of service (QoS) policy authorization. By associating another project's QoS policy with an amphora, an authenticated user may prevent deletion of that policy. All Octavia deployments are affected.

AI Analysis

Impact

OpenStack Octavia up to version 18.0.0 incorrectly handles authorization for quality of service policies. By associating a QoS policy from another project with an amphora, an authenticated user can prevent that policy from being deleted. The result is an unprivileged user can persist unwanted or insecure QoS configurations. The weakness is an authorization bypass (CWE-863).

Affected Systems

All Octavia deployments using OpenStack Octavia up to and including version 18.0.0 are affected. The issue impacts the Octavia component that manages amphora resources and their QoS policy associations.

Risk and Exploitability

The CVSS score of 4.3 indicates moderate severity. EPSS is not available, so the current likelihood of exploitation is unknown, and the vulnerability is not listed in CISA's KEV catalog. Attackers only need authenticated access to Octavia and can associate an external QoS policy to an amphora to prevent its deletion. This does not grant higher privileges but allows an attacker to keep unwanted QoS policies in place.
